Description
The HDMI over IP solution includes transmitters and receivers which can be used as
point to point extenders up to 120m or when connected to a Gigabit LAN they can create
any size HDMI matrix. Transmitters encode the HDMI sources to H.264 and stream the
signals over the LAN, receivers then decode these streams by selecting any of the
transmitters located on the LAN. Matrix switching is controlled using buttons on
the front panels, infra-red control, PC software or APP’s available on iOS and Android.
The units also provide infra-red return path for controlling the source devices such
as DVD’s, SAT, FreeView.
